Founded in 1933, State University "Kyiv Aviation Institute" is a non-profit public higher education institution located in the urban setting of the metropolis of Kyiv (population range of 1,000,000-5,000,000 inhabitants), Kiev Oblast. This institution also has branch campuses in Slovyansk, Kryviy Rih, Kremenchuk and Vasylkov. Officially recognized by the Ministry of Education and Science of Ukraine, State University "Kyiv Aviation Institute" (KAI) is a large-sized (uniRank enrollment range: 10,000-14,999 students) coeducational Ukrainian higher education institution. State University "Kyiv Aviation Institute" (KAI) offers courses and programs leading to officially recognized higher education degrees such as pre-bachelor's degrees (i.e. certificates, diplomas, associate or foundation), bachelor's degrees, master's degrees and doctorate degrees in several areas of study. This 92-year-old Ukrainian higher-education institution has a selective admission policy based on entrance examinations. The acceptance rate range is 50-59% making this Ukrainian higher education organization an averagely selective institution. International students are welcome to apply for enrollment. KAI also provides several academic and non-academic facilities and services to students including a library, housing, sports facilities, study abroad and exchange programs, online courses and distance learning opportunities, as well as administrative services.
